Valiant Championship Wrestling

Today on Sunday, 6th January 2030, VCW signed its first female wrestlers. The names of the four women are Wildflower, Miss Fortune, Violette and Velvet. Wildflower and Miss Fortune are the ones to be in the first one on one women's match in VCW. These two women have the oppotunity to make history at the upcoming PPV, The New Era.

Vijaypratap Panwar, Chairman and CEO of Valiant Championship Wrestling, said in an recent interview with Rajeev Chauhan from Daily Pratapgadh News, "We are excited to showcase our women's division to the world and believe that women's wrestling can be more than what we view it as. Miss Fortune and Wildflower are amazing talents that deserve this opportunity to make history in VCW. We are also preparing a singles tournament for women which is called the Lioness Cup. Sixteen talented females will fight in elimination matches to get to the final two and the victor receives the prestigious Lioness Cup. This would be great opportunity to display our talented women's division. We aspire to enhance women's wrestling and also have the best women's division in the world."

VCW signs a TV deal with Chiraag TV



12th August, 2030 - The Chairman and CEO of Valiant Championship Wrestling, Vijaypratap Panwar, is glad to announce that the company has signed a TV deal with Chiraag TV to air Tuesday Night BRUTALITY and VCW Pay-Per-Views in Pratapgadh. Chiraag TV is new rising broadcasting corporation in Pratapgadh that has is interested in having wrestling on their channels. Chiraag TV is very comman in the state of Maratha Pradesa and Gujarat and is also present in the southern part of the state of Rajputana. As VCW has signed a deal with Hinodejin-Futurnian Alliance of Broadcasting to air Tuesday Night BRUTALITY in Kita-Hinode, it is finally time for VCW to appear on the televisions of its home country.

The CEO of Chiraag TV, Hari Samant, said in a press conference, "We are glad to have Valiant Championship Wrestling airing on our channels. I have been a fan pro wrestling since childhood and today I have the opportunity to support pro wrestling in Pratapgadh. We fully support VCW and their ambitions and we will help them achieve that here in Pratapgadh."

Vijaypratap Panwar also gave a statement in the press conference, "We had a deal with Hinodejin-Futurnian Alliance of Broadcasting to air Tuesday Night BRUTALITY in Kita-Hinode. We were glad to have that opportunity to expand VCW to the global audience. However, we still didn't have TV deal here in our beautiful country, Pratapgadh. We know that the audience here is eager to see VCW on their televisions and we cannot neglect them. With this deal, we finally get into the hearts of Pratapgadhis. We are glad that Chiraag TV is the one to work with us as we know their passion for pro wrestling. Together, we will create the golden age of pro wrestling here in Pratapgadh."

According to the deal, VCW Pay-Per-Views will be live on channels Chiraag Firesports 1. Tuesday Night BRUTALITY will air live from 5:00 PM to 7:00 PM Pratapgadhi Time on Tuesdays. The channels you can watch Tuesday Night BRUTALITY on is Chiraag TV14 and Chiraag Firesports 2. Pratapgadh wants some BRUTALITY!

The Lioness Cup will see Joshi wrestlers participate



12th August, 2030 - VCW has said in a recent press conference to hype the Lioness Cup that we will be seeing Joshi wrestlers from Kita-Hinode participate in the Lioness Cup. These wrestlers are 18-year-olds that have been trained in Iwashigahama Hinode's Women Pro Wrestling Academy, this is probably one of the biggest opportunities they will be getting from VCW.

Vijaypratap Panwar, Chairman and CEO of Valiant Championship Wrestling, said in the press conference, "We are glad to have them compete in this prestigious tournament. It is a once in a lifetime opportunity and in my opinion, these young joshi wrestlers deserve this opportunity. We haven't signed them yet and will release the names next week or sooner. They will get to prove themselves and if they are successful, they can get a VCW contract and appear on episodes of Tuesday Night BRUTALITY. We again like to thank Iwashigahama Hinode's Women Pro Wrestling Academy for helping us making this tournament successful and we know that the young females won't disappoint them."

VCW has currently signed about 4 wrestlers and all of them are competing in the tournament. We will have to wait and see who arrives and sign up to take on others for the Lioness Cup.
